underrated sitcoms - Alright, so let's rewind to 1992, shall we? This was the year that changed everything for Toronto baseball. The Toronto Blue Jays clinched their first-ever World Series title, and believe me, the city went absolutely bonkers! They faced off against the Atlanta Braves, and the series was a nail-biter from start to finish. The team, led by stars like Roberto Alomar, Joe Carter, and Dave Stieb, displayed a perfect combination of talent and grit. The energy in the Skydome (now the Rogers Centre) was electric, and you could feel the excitement building with every game. Toronto was hungry for a championship, and the Blue Jays were determined to deliver. The games were filled with dramatic moments, clutch hits, and outstanding pitching performances. The intensity was palpable, and every at-bat felt like a battle. The city was united in support of its team, and the atmosphere was unlike anything anyone had ever experienced before. The 1992 World Series wasn't just a series of baseball games; it was a cultural phenomenon that united a city and ignited a passion for the sport that continues to this day. *This victory was a pivotal moment*, etching the Blue Jays' name in history and setting the stage for even more memorable achievements. The journey to the championship was a test of skill, teamwork, and sheer determination. Every player contributed, every game mattered, and the collective effort brought home the ultimate prize. The team's resilience and unwavering focus under pressure inspired a generation of fans, solidifying the Blue Jays as a symbol of Toronto pride and success. The legacy of the 1992 World Series extends beyond the championship itself. It laid the foundation for future success, setting the standard for excellence and instilling a winning mentality that would continue to drive the team forward. The unforgettable memories of that season are still cherished by fans who witnessed history firsthand, and its impact on the city's sporting identity is undeniable.

Alright, let's get down to brass tacks: the **Indonesian National Police (POLRI)**, or *Kepolisian Negara Republik Indonesia* in Indonesian, is the official police force of Indonesia. Think of it as the Indonesian equivalent of the FBI or Scotland Yard, but with its own unique characteristics and responsibilities. The POLRI is a centralized organization, meaning it operates under a unified command structure that answers to the President of Indonesia. That's right, the President is at the top of the food chain! They are responsible for maintaining law and order, ensuring public safety, and upholding the legal system across the entire archipelago. From bustling city streets to remote islands, the POLRI's presence is felt everywhere. The police are responsible for preventing and investigating crimes, as well as providing various community services, such as traffic underrated sitcoms control and disaster relief. The POLRI's mission goes way beyond just catching bad guys. It's all about ensuring the safety and well-being of the Indonesian people. It plays a massive role in maintaining the country's stability, which is essential for economic development and social harmony. This is the official police force that protects the lives and properties of the citizens of Indonesia. The police force is a crucial component of the Indonesian government, and its operations have a direct impact on the lives of all Indonesians. The police force operates according to the law and is under the command of the Chief of the Indonesian National Police. The police force is responsible for enforcing the law and maintaining public order, as well as protecting the lives and properties of the citizens of Indonesia.
